Hill Hydroseeding in Ventura County, CA
Hill Hydroseeding services involve applying a mixture of seed, mulch, fertilizer, and water to bare or disturbed soil to establish a healthy, lush lawn or ground cover. This method is commonly used for residential projects such as lawn restoration, hillside stabilization, erosion control, or creating new lawns on residential properties. Homeowners typically seek this service to quickly and effectively establish grass in areas that are difficult to seed by hand, ensuring even coverage and rapid growth.
Before requesting hydroseeding, property owners often want to understand the suitability of their soil, the types of grass or ground cover best suited for their landscape, and any preparation needed prior to application. It’s also helpful to consider the overall condition of the site, including slope stability and drainage, to ensure successful growth. Clear communication about project goals and site conditions can help determine the most appropriate seed mix and application techniques for a successful and sustained lawn or ground cover.

Hill Hydroseeding Questions
What areas are suitable for hydroseeding? Hydroseeding is effective on slopes, large lawns, and areas needing quick grass establishment across Ventura County.
What types of projects benefit from hydroseeding? It is ideal for residential lawns, commercial landscapes, erosion control, and reseeding disturbed areas.
How does hydroseeding compare to traditional seeding? Hydroseeding provides faster coverage and better soil contact, resulting in quicker germination compared to manual planting.
What should property owners prepare before hydroseeding? The area should be cleared of debris, and soil should be properly graded for optimal seed contact and growth.
